3.1 Actions
Click [Action] to change the conveyor width and scan the board.
Figure 7: VPLC/Control Toolbar/Actions
In the [Actions] menu, the following options will be displayed:
Start
The conveyor sends the board to the default position and
clips it. Left and right gates will be closed.
Reset
The conveyor releases the board. The machine opens the
gate and sends the board to the gate.
Lock
The machine locks the front and rear doors and both gates.
The conveyor clips the board.
Maintenance
Open the front door and let the conveyor release the board.
Manual Width
Click to change the conveyor width manually. Another window
will pop up to remind you to remove the board from the
conveyor first.

Auto Width
Click to move the conveyor to the correct position based on
the value you input in the field.
Input the conveyor width in this field and click on the [Auto
Width] button to move the conveyor to the correct position.
You also can use the [Up Arrow] and [Down Arrow] buttons to
change the width 1mm for each step.
Figure 8: VPLC/Actions
After clicking any button above, users can click the [Stop] button to terminate the process
and go back to the previous window.

3.2 Modes
Select [Modes] to choose the test mode and I/O settings. After choosing [Modes], the window
below will appear
Figure 10: VPLC/Modes
Press [Mode] to choose in between three modes: [Stand Along
],
[In-Line], or [Test]. The
setting will be automatically stored during shut down, and automatically loaded at the next
power on.
Stand Along: The machine is not connected to external equipment for testing. This mode
requires manual loading and unloading.
a) If the Mode is set to [Stand Along], [Direction] menu has [Left-In-Right-Out], [Left-In-
Left-Out], [Right-In-Left-Out] and [Right-In-Right-Out] options. For example, [Left-In-
Right-Out] means that the tested board will be delivered into the machine form the left
gate and sent out from the right gate.
b) If the Mode is set to [Stand Along], then [Start Mode] menu has [Test Once] and
[Continuous Test] options.
In-line: The machine connects to external equipment for inline testing.
a) If the Mode is set to [In-line], [Direction] menu has [Left-In-Right-Out], [Left-In-Left-
Out], [Right-In-Left-Out] and [Right-In-Right-Out] options.
b) If the Mode is set to [In-line], then [Start Mode] menu has [Start Test] option.
Test: Single board test. The machine does not connect to external equipment.
a) If the Mode is set to [Test], [Direction] menu has [Left-In-Left-Out] and [Right-In-Right-
Out] options.
b) If the Mode is set to [Test], then [Start Mode] menu has [Test Once] option.
